document.write( "Question 1136300: The first term of an arithmetic series is -12 and the last term is 22. The sum of all the terms of the series is 260. Find the common difference of the series. \n" ); document.write( "

\n" ); document.write( "The sum of all the terms of an arithmetic series is the number of terms, multiplied by the average of the first and last terms. From the given information,

\n" ); document.write( "\"n%28%28-12%2B22%29%2F2%29+=+260\"
\n" ); document.write( "\"5n+=+260\"
\n" ); document.write( "\"n+=+52\"

\n" ); document.write( "There are 52 terms in the sequence. The 52nd term is the first term plus the common difference 51 times:

\n" ); document.write( "\"22+=+-12%2B51d\"
\n" ); document.write( "\"34+=+51d\"
\n" ); document.write( "\"d+=+34%2F51+=+2%2F3\"

\n" ); document.write( "The common difference in the series is 2/3.
